Tata Motors Passenger Vehicles Ltd has submitted the SIAM report for the period of October to December 2025. This submission is in accordance with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The report includes data on production, domestic sales, and exports for various vehicle models.
In the Compact category, which includes models such as Zest, Bolt, Tiago, Tigor, and Altroz, production increased from 22,584 units in Q4 2024 to 31,688 units in Q4 2025. Domestic sales for this category rose from 24,446 units to 32,777 units in the same period. Exports for this category also saw an increase from 231 units to 1,484 units.
The UVC category, featuring models like Nexon and Punch, reported a production increase from 86,021 units in Q4 2024 to 114,393 units in Q4 2025. Domestic sales in this category grew from 89,870 units to 115,435 units, while exports increased from 160 units to 457 units.
Figures for other categories, such as UV1 and UV2, also showed variations in production, domestic sales, and exports. The report notes that these figures have not been independently verified and audited, and final figures may vary post-audit.
